Yet again, the new 992.2 Porsche 911 Carrera GTS has won a prestigious award.
The 911 Carrera GTS also won Newsweek magazine's "World's Greatest Auto Disruptor" award.

Timo Resch, CEO of Porsche North America, said:
"The idea of a high-performance hybrid Porsche has been around for more than a decade. As with many other technologies, Porsche has developed its expertise in the competitive arena of motorsport. The 911 GT3 R Hybrid combines internal combustion engine and electric performance."

"Currently, several Cayenne and Panamera variants are available with plug-in hybrid powertrains, further enhancing performance. The most logical next step for the 911 was to apply the learnings from previous projects to create an extremely sporty, lightweight hybrid system that improves driving performance while minimizing weight."

"This is a truly disruptive idea in the sports car segment, so winning this award is very meaningful."
